| """ |
| SAGE — corpus builder. |
| |
| Real run: you supply each tradition's PUBLIC-DOMAIN text as a normalized verse |
| file (JSONL of {"reference": "...", "text": "..."}), and this windows consecutive |
| verses into reference-tagged chunks for embedding. The normalized-verse contract |
| keeps source-specific scraping (Gutenberg/Sacred-Texts/CCEL layouts) out of the |
| pipeline while guaranteeing every chunk carries locators that match the gold set. |
| |
| Demo run (`--seed-demo`): synthesizes a self-contained corpus covering every |
| reference in REFERENCE_MAP, with motif-themed chunk text and some verse-level |
| splitting, so the index + evaluation harness runs with no downloads. |
| |
| Chunk schema (JSONL): |
| {"chunk_id","tradition","reference","references":[...],"text"} |
| `references` is the list of component locators in the chunk; the evaluator counts |
| a chunk as relevant if ANY component overlaps a gold label. |
| |
| Sources manifest (recommended public-domain editions): |
| """ |

| def window_chunks(verses, tradition, size=3, stride=2): |
| """Group consecutive verses into reference-tagged chunks, without crossing a |
| `section` boundary (book+chapter), so chunks stay topically coherent. |
| |
| `verses`: list of {"reference","text","section"?} in document order. |
| Returns chunk dicts. Component references are preserved for matching. |
| """ |
| |
| runs, cur, last = [], [], object() |
| for v in verses: |
| sec = v.get("section") |
| if cur and sec != last: |
| runs.append(cur); cur = [] |
| cur.append(v); last = sec |
| if cur: |
| runs.append(cur) |
|
|
| chunks = [] |
| for run in runs: |
| i, n = 0, len(run) |
| while i < n: |
| group = run[i:i + size] |
| refs = [v["reference"] for v in group] |
| chunks.append({ |
| "tradition": tradition, |
| "reference": _combine(refs), |
| "references": refs, |
| "text": " ".join(v["text"].strip() for v in group), |
| }) |
| i += stride |
| return chunks |
|
|
|
|
| def _combine(refs): |
| """Build a display locator spanning a group of component refs when possible.""" |
| if len(refs) == 1: |
| return refs[0] |
| a, b = parse_ref(refs[0]), parse_ref(refs[-1]) |
| if a.work == b.work and not a.is_token and not b.is_token: |
| if a.chapter == b.chapter and a.chapter is not None: |
| sep = ":" if ":" in refs[0] else "." |
| head = refs[0].rsplit(sep, 1)[0] |
| return f"{head}{sep}{a.v_start}-{b.v_end or b.v_start}" |
| if a.chapter is None and b.chapter is None: |
| head = refs[0].rsplit(" ", 1)[0] |
| return f"{head} {a.v_start}-{b.v_end or b.v_start}" |
| return f"{refs[0]} … {refs[-1]}" |
